Big Lagoon: The Iconic Gateway

The tour kicks off with a visit to the Big Lagoon, arguably El Nido’s most recognizable feature. The calm waters, framed by towering limestone cliffs, create a scene straight out of a postcard. You’ll sail in a traditional outrigger boat—an authentic touch—and get plenty of chances to snap photos of the dramatic scenery.
Authentic tip: The journey through the lagoon is peaceful, and the clear waters are perfect for a quick swim. From reviews, we know that guides like Jake excel at making sure everyone gets good angles and feels comfortable during the boat rides.

Secret Lagoon: A Hidden Gem

One of the tour’s highlights is the Secret Lagoon, accessed through a small limestone opening. Once inside, you find a tiny, enclosed pool surrounded by cliffs—an intimate spot for a quick dip or photos. The small opening can be tricky for some, so a moderate level of agility helps.
Insight from reviews: Guides like Jake are experienced in helping guests navigate these openings, and visitors appreciate the “hidden” aspect that makes this lagoon feel like a secret discovery.

Is this tour suitable for all fitness levels?
Moderate physical fitness is recommended, especially since some spots like the Secret Lagoon opening may require some agility. The boat rides are comfortable, but be prepared for some walking and swimming.
What’s included in the price?
The tour price covers private round-trip transportation, an English-speaking guide, all entrance fees, lunch, and bottled water. Extra expenses like souvenirs or additional snacks are not included.
How long does the tour last?
The entire experience lasts approximately 9 hours, from pickup to drop-off, allowing plenty of time at each stop without feeling rushed.
